Buses are energy-efficient. Carrying a passenger over 100 kms by coach only takes 0.6-0.9 liters of gas. Compare that to the 2.6 liters required by high-speed train, 6.6 liters by airplane and 7.6 liters by gas-powered car, and it's clear that the bus is a more environmentally-conscious option for your bus transportation from Oviedo to Amarante.

The average number of passengers on a coach bus is 32 meaning that a bus could replace a minimum of at least 30 cars!

9.2% of ground transportation in Europe is done by bus versus 7.4% by train.
